             Shipping/ Production Associate Supply Chain & Logistics Houston, TX, US Pay Rate Low: 16 | Pay Rate High: 16 + Added - 27/10/2025 Apply for Job Shipping Production Worker - Hours: 8-5pm M-F - Pay: $16/hr - Location: Houston, TX - Terms: 6 month contract-to-hire Job Summary: The Shipping Production Worker plays a crucial role in ensuring the smooth and efficient operation of our outbound shipments. This position involves a combination of production, shipping, and kit assembly. The ideal candidate is a reliable and hardworking individual with a strong work ethic and a commitment to safety and quality. This is an on-premise position. Primary Responsibilities: • Assemble goods on production lines according to specifications. • Monitor the production process and report any issues to the supervisor. • Carry out essential quality and testing checks to ensure product quality. Pack goods for shipping, ensuring proper packaging and labeling, including pallet wrapping. • Assemble and pack outbound shipments, ensuring accuracy and completeness. • Maintain accurate records of shipped items outbound and inbound, as required. • Neatly store goods and raw materials properly in designated areas, including current stock and procurement shipments. • Ensure cleanliness and organization of the inventory supply • Report any areas of clutter, unsafe conditions, or cleanliness issues to appropriate personnel. • Assist in general tasks, including cleaning and organizing shared spaces, as needed. • Handle multifaceted tasks within a fluid environment, adapting quickly to changing priorities and projects as needed. • Document processes thoroughly, ensuring clarity and ease of understanding for all team members. • Other Shipping duties as assigned including assisting the receiving team with pallet deliveries. Skills: • Punctuality and reliability. • Ability to work independently and as part of a team. • Attention to detail and accuracy. • Ability to complete assembly line repetitive tasks efficiently. • Good communication skills. • Flexibility and adaptability. • Commitment to safety and quality. • Strong critical thinking skills, ability to approach problems analytically, and a proactive approach to resolving issues. • Solid foundation in standard operating procedures (SOPs) and ability to work with SOP documents effectively. • Customer-focused mindset, with a commitment to providing excellent service to internal and external stakeholders. • Ability to effectively document processes and present them to others. Required Qualifications: • Must be fluent in English. • Must be able to lift 50 lbs. and stand for long periods at a time. • Must be able to work extended hours, weekends, and some holidays.
